NDSS Gestational Diabetes: Support and Resources for Pregnant Women

Gestational diabetes is a condition that affects pregnant women, causing high blood sugar levels. It is crucial for women with gestational diabetes to have access to the right support and resources to effectively manage their condition and ensure a healthy pregnancy. The National Diabetes Services Scheme (NDSS) is an Australian initiative that provides valuable support and resources specifically tailored for women with gestational diabetes.

The NDSS offers a range of services to assist pregnant women in managing their gestational diabetes. One of the key benefits is access to subsidised diabetes-related products, such as blood glucose monitoring strips and insulin. This helps to alleviate the financial burden associated with managing the condition, ensuring that women have the necessary tools to monitor their blood sugar levels and administer insulin, if required.

In addition to providing subsidised products, the NDSS offers educational resources and information to empower pregnant women with knowledge about gestational diabetes. They provide brochures, fact sheets, and online resources that cover various aspects of the condition, including its causes, symptoms, and management strategies. These resources help women understand the importance of blood sugar control, healthy eating, and physical activity during pregnancy.

The NDSS also facilitates access to diabetes healthcare professionals who specialize in gestational diabetes. These professionals, including diabetes educators, dietitians, and nurses, play a crucial role in providing personalized care and guidance to pregnant women. They offer one-on-one consultations, group education sessions, and ongoing support to help women develop the necessary skills and confidence in managing their gestational diabetes effectively.

Furthermore, the NDSS organizes workshops and events specifically designed for women with gestational diabetes. These events provide an opportunity for pregnant women to connect with others who are going through a similar experience. They can share their concerns, ask questions, and learn from each other's experiences. These workshops also often feature expert speakers who provide valuable insights and practical tips for managing gestational diabetes.

The NDSS recognizes the importance of postnatal care for women who have had gestational diabetes. They offer ongoing support and resources to help women transition into the postpartum period and maintain healthy blood sugar levels. This includes information on breastfeeding, healthy eating, and the importance of regular check-ups to monitor blood sugar levels and detect any potential long-term complications.
